video that sparked a lot of As of January 1, 2018, about 200 laws were enacted in Illinois. Here are 10 new laws that may be of im-
negative reactions. In the vid- portance to you.
eo, Logan Paul vlogs his trip
to Japan as he goes into the 1. Due to the rise of vandalism of religious places across the state, crimes that are committed at places
Aokigahara Forest, which is of worship can now be tried as hate crimes.
infamous in Japan for being 2. 16 and 17 year-olds can now sign up to be organ and tissue donors when receiving a driver’s license,
haunted and more importantly, although parents can revoke this consent until the age of 18.
the popularity of it among sui- 3. Transgender people can change their sex designation on their birth certificate without transition sur-
cide victims, so much so that it Screenshot of Logan Paul in the controversial video. gery.
is even nicknamed “The Suicide 4. To eradicate “pink-tax”, where women are charged more than men for the same service, hair salons,
Photo Credit: The Sun
Forest”. barbers, dry cleaners, and tailors will be required to provide consumers with a price list for services if
For those of you who don’t requested.
know who Logan Paul is, he is a YouTube something to think about. 5. Schools can no longer expel Pre-K students for behavior issues, but rather they must find programs to
vlogger with over 15 million subscribers help the pupils fix their problems.
on his YouTube channel who got his start 6. Schools will be required to provide a space other than a bathroom for students to safely breastfeed,
in internet fame in Vine (rip). and must provide free feminine hygiene products.
Logan Paul was in Japan’s suicide for- 7. A “trigger law” is removed that could potentially make abortions illegal if Roe v. Wade is overturned
est, at the base of Mount Fuji, and could be by the Supreme Court. Abortions are also covered under Medicaid and the health insurance plans of state
heard yelling "yo, are you alive?" at the employees.
dead man during the 15-minute clip. The 8. Determining who gets to keep a pet during a divorce will now be decided by court when the two
camera then zoomed into the man's body, parties are in disagreement. The courts can allocate joint or sole ownership of pets, depending on its well-
while Logan asked his tour guide: "Did we being.
just find a dead person in the suicide forest 9. Illinois becomes the first state to officially ban the use of elephants in circuses.
hanging?" Logan eventually deleted the 10. It is now illegal to drive a car which has signs, decals, or paperwork on the front windshield which
video, and issued an apology on Twitter may obscure the view of the driver. This applies to drivers who are looking to test drive vehicles from a
around 24 hours after the clip went up. dealership.
Once the video was uploaded the reac-
tion was swift and savage with other voices Other interesting notes include that cycling is now Illinois’s official exercise, corn is the state grain, and
from YouTube and Social Media criticiz- August 4 will be recognized as Barack Obama Day.
